    Community Opinions on new interactive furniture idea.

    Had an idea last night, and bounced it off my buddies in my raid static and they all really liked it. I wanted to post it here and maybe gather some thoughts from the forum community as well.

    It would be pretty cool if we could have aquarium's in our houses as furniture. And what would be even cooler, is if the fishermen/women of Eorzea could stock those aquariums with the fish they caught.

    You could even do different size aquariums with differing difficulty/material requirements. Make the large aquarium a 3star craft and allow it to be big enough to display those rare Big Fishing fish. Or make a small aquarium with your level 45 crafter if you want to show off that HQ Ogre Barracuda you just mooched. Make it to where you can change the fish you have in the aquarium in and out at will.

    Small aquarium can display 2 types of fish
    Medium aquarium can display 4 types of fish
    Large aquarium can display 8 types of fish or 2 "big fish"

    Or you know, whatever. The values don't have to be set in stone or anything. Just guidelines for something that I think could add some diversity to people's homes and be a fun way to continuously customize something in your home.
